A Wonderful New World, a science fiction novel published by Aldous Huxley in 1932, portrays a future society under mechanized civilization. In that world, humanity is stripped away by machinery. People living in a state of "e;happiness"e; are predetermined by caste and hatched from test tubes and incubators. Embryos are divided into different castes, from low to high, and receive different training.Those of lower castes are short and ugly, performing the most menial jobs in society; while those of higher castes are tall and beautiful, forming the upper echelon of society.In this new world, everyone is happy, and everyone's happiness is identical. The book's reflection on technological development and concern for the fate of humanity make it a banner in the "e;dystopian"e; literature of the twentieth century.
